Who is Neder Kaleth Hernández?
Neder has done the whole process of Basic Forces with La Colla, as he started from the Under 13 category with Monterrey, going through the categories
Under 15, Under 17 and now with the Under 20, with which he had his best tournament in the past Opening 2020, scoring 6 goals in the 13 games he played.
